K082097 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the DEMETECH POLYDIOXANONE SYNTHETIC MONOFILAMENT (PDO) ABSORBABLE SUTURE. Classified as Suture, Surgical, Absorbable, Polydioxanone (product code NEW),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Demetech Corp. (Miami,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on January 8, 2010 after a review of 533 days - an unusually long review period, suggesting complex equivalence evaluation.

This device falls under the General & Plastic Surgery F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 878.4840 - the FDA general and plastic surgery device fram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
